為您選擇合適的傳感器:上升型還是下降型?

左圖:下降型DAG在二酰基甘油水平增加時(shí),熒光強(qiáng)度從亮變暗。這種檢測方法在熒光板讀數(shù)器上容易被檢測到,有助于成像那些表達(dá)效率低的細(xì)胞。
右圖:上升型DAG在二酰基甘油水平增加時(shí),熒光強(qiáng)度從暗變亮。這種DAG檢測方法在熒光板讀數(shù)器或成像系統(tǒng)上容易被檢測到。
